Yes, it's been a little different for sure. With regard to trains running off their normal schedules, I believe that 382/383 had their crew calls changed, and what you are seeing now is the new normal. 384/385 seem to usually be running pretty close to their old schedules again, although todays 384 was quite early. Been a ton of extras running as well, along with 271 (repositioning train for Flat Rock) appearing almost daily. 533S/533N fairly close to normal times through MTC. Lots of major track work scheduled for this summer - may throw things off for a spell too.
